Everyone can own a home. If you own the home outright and use it for your living residence, then it is not considered an asset or an investment. Even if you have a lot of equity in this home, you owe money each month, either in the form of property taxes and insurance, or general maintenance that comes out of your pocket. In real estate, in order to consider your real estate as an investment earning real estate cash flow, you must be able to create cash flow with that asset. This is done in many ways, depending which method interests you the most.
